A SILVER-GILT AND GUILLOCHÉ ENAMEL PHOTOGRAPH FRAME
BY FABERGÉ, WORKMASTER MICHAEL PERCHIN, ST PETERSBURG, CIRCA 1890, SCRATCHED INVENTORY NUMBER 45943
Of shaped cartouche form, the oval aperture inset with a miniature porcelain portrait of Queen Olga of Greece, signed 'Pasetti' and numbered '52320' on the reverse, within a laurel-capped reeded bezel, the body enamelled in translucent emerald green over a sunburst guilloché ground, applied with rocaille and foliate silver mounts, with an ivorine back and silver strut, marked on lower edge and strut with 'Fabergé' in Cyrillic and workmaster's initials; in the original fitted Fabergé wooden case
4 3⁄8 in. (11.2 cm.) high

Provenance
Anonymous sale; Sotheby's, London, 9 November 2000, lot 89.
